diff --git a/.gitignore b/.gitignore index 1be2761..fac201c 100644 --- a/.gitignore +++ b/.gitignore @@ -1,5 +1,6 @@ /mmv /goxz +/CREDITS *.exe *.test *.out diff --git a/Makefile b/Makefile index 58451e7..cee0572 100644 --- a/Makefile +++ b/Makefile @@ -25,12 +25,19 @@ $(GOBIN)/gobump: @cd && go get github.com/x-motemen/gobump/cmd/gobump .PHONY: cross -cross: $(GOBIN)/goxz +cross: $(GOBIN)/goxz CREDITS goxz -n $(BIN) -pv=v$(VERSION) -build-ldflags=$(BUILD_LDFLAGS) ./cmd/$(BIN) $(GOBIN)/goxz: cd && go get github.com/Songmu/goxz/cmd/goxz +CREDITS: $(GOBIN)/gocredits go.sum + go mod tidy + gocredits -w . + +$(GOBIN)/gocredits: + cd && go get github.com/Songmu/gocredits/cmd/gocredits + .PHONY: test test: build go test -v ./... @@ -45,7 +52,7 @@ $(GOBIN)/golint: .PHONY: clean clean: - rm -rf $(BIN) goxz + rm -rf $(BIN) goxz CREDITS go clean .PHONY: bump